Here it is for those interested: http://www.raynersrange.com/schedule.htm
It's basically the same pattern as 2010 with the rifle match on the 4th Sunday of each month except there will not be a regular rifle match in April due to Easter. The plan as of right now is to have a more "Tactical" type match on April 10 and Oct. 30 with trails, movement and various firing positions. I'm sure we'll hear more about that next year.
If you want to break out a short gun the pistol matches are the 3rd Sunday of each month and a Multigun match is scheduled for July 31st. See you all next year.

Yep, that's the way to do it. The only targets you can't shoot at during the pistol match are the 900-1000.

One note ..... on the Rayner's web page is says matches start at 8:00, but that is for the pistol matches. Rifle matches are still registration open at 9:00 and rounds down range at 10:00. For the pistol match you can start whenever you get there and there is enough for a squad(you don't have to start at any certain time).
